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our technicians will walk you through the process, explaining what to expect and how we’ll work together to get the job done. We’ll set up containment procedures to prevent cross-contamination and ensure a safe working environment.
Step 2: Moisture Removal
We’ll use specialized equipment to identify and remove moisture sources, which is key to preventing mold and bacterial growth. This may involve using industrial-strength fans, dehumidifiers, or other equipment to remove excess moisture.
Step 3: Treatment and Cleaning
Our technicians will apply a specialized treatment to the affected area to remove mold and bacteria. We’ll also clean and disinfect the area to prevent future growth.
Step 4: Drying and Monitoring
Once the treatment is complete, our technicians will monitor the area to ensure it’s dry and free of moisture. We’ll also provide you with guidance on how to maintain a healthy environment and prevent future issues.

Warning Signs You Need Antimicrobial Treatment Services
Don’t ignore the warning signs, they can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common indicators that you need professional help: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old or bacterial growth. If you notice a persistent smell, it’s time to call in the professionals.
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ew
Black or greenish patches on walls, ceilings, or floors are a clear indication of mold or mildew growth. Don’t delay, the longer you wait, the bigger the problem will become.
Water Stains or Leaks
Excess moisture can lead to mold and bacterial growth. If you notice water stains or leaks,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Respiratory Issues or Allergies
Mold and bacteria can trigger respiratory issues or allergies. If you or a family member is experiencing symptoms, it’s crucial to identify and address the source of the problem.
Unexplained Health Issues
Mold and bacteria can also contribute to unexplained health issues, such as headaches or fatigue. Don’t ignore these symptoms, they may be related to a hidden mold or bacterial infestation.
Antimicrobial Treatment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small mold patch on a wall | Yes | No | You can likely treat it yourself with a DIY kit. |
| Visible signs of mold or mildew in a large area | No | Yes | It’s best to call a professional to ensure a thorough and effective treatment. |
| Water stains or leaks that need extensive repairs | No | Yes | A professional can help you identify and address the underlying issue. |
| Respiratory issues or allergies that may be related to mold or bacteria | No | Yes | A professional can help you identify and address the source of the problem. |
| Unexplained health issues that may be related to mold or bacteria | No | Yes | A professional can help you identify and address the source of the problem. |
